Maine’s capitol, in Augusta, was the eighth capitol I photographed, and is tied with Massachusetts for my most visited. The Maine Capitol sits along the Kennebec River in Augusta and can be seen from all over the small capital city. The dome was restored to its original copper color between my first and most recent visits, so you’ll see both the old oxidized green and the restored versions here. The first photo here is probably my single favorite state capitol photo I’ve taken. These photos were taken over several trips from October of 2012 to July of 2015.
